A Bill to Rein in Excessive Presidential Tariff Power

 


BE IT ENACTED BY THE CONGRESS HERE ASSEMBLED THAT:

Section 1.      Section 232 of the Trade Expansion Act of 1962 is hereby repealed.

SECTION 2.      All currently effective tariffs that were enacted by the President after a Commerce Department report justified by Section 232 of the Trade Expansion Act of 1962 are hereby declared null and void.

SECTION 3.      Any attempt by the President to enact tariffs based on Section 232 of the Trade Expansion Act of 1962 after the passage of this legislation shall be considered grounds for impeachment and removal from office.

Section 4.      This legislation shall go into effect immediately.

Section 5.      All laws in conflict with this legislation are hereby declared null and void.
